Product Introduction

Overview

The LM5088QMHX-1/NOPB, produced by Texas Instruments, is a wide input range non-synchronous buck controller designed for high-voltage step-down conversion. This controller features all the necessary functions to implement an efficient buck converter using a minimum number of external components. It operates over an ultra-wide input voltage range of 4.5 V to 75 V and is based on peak current mode control utilizing an emulated current ramp. This approach provides inherent line voltage feedforward, cycle-by-cycle current limiting, and ease of loop compensation. The LM5088 is available in two versions: LM5088-1 with a ±5% frequency dithering function for EMI reduction, and LM5088-2 with a versatile restart timer for overload protection.

Key Features

  • Ultra-wide input voltage range from 4.5 V to 75 V.
  • Peak current mode control with emulated current ramp for reduced noise sensitivity and reliable operation at high input voltages.
  • Programmable switching frequency from 50 kHz to 1 MHz.
  • ±5% frequency dithering function (LM5088-1) for EMI reduction.
  • Versatile restart timer for overload protection (LM5088-2).
  • Low dropout bias regulator and high voltage, low dropout bias supply.
  • Tri-level enable input for shutdown and standby modes.
  • Soft start and oscillator synchronization capability.
  • Thermal shutdown protection).
  • AEC-Q100 qualified with device temperature grade 1: –40°C to +125°C ambient operating temperature range).

Applications

  • Automotive infotainment and USB accessory adapters).
  • Industrial DC-DC bias and motor drivers).
  • Telecom applications requiring high-voltage step-down conversion).

Q & A

  1. What is the input voltage range of the LM5088?

    The LM5088 operates over an ultra-wide input voltage range of 4.5 V to 75 V.

  2. What are the two versions of the LM5088 and their key differences?

    The LM5088 is available in two versions: LM5088-1 with a ±5% frequency dithering function for EMI reduction, and LM5088-2 with a versatile restart timer for overload protection).

  3. What is the operating temperature range of the LM5088?

    The operating temperature range of the LM5088 is –40°C to +125°C).

  4. How is the switching frequency of the LM5088 programmed?

    The switching frequency of the LM5088 is programmable from 50 kHz to 1 MHz using a single resistor between the RT pin and the GND pin).

  5. What is the purpose of the emulated current ramp in the LM5088?

    The emulated current ramp reduces noise sensitivity of the pulse-width modulation circuit, allowing reliable control of very small duty cycles necessary in high input voltage and low output voltage applications).

  6. What are the key features of the VCC regulator in the LM5088?

    The VCC regulator provides a high voltage, low-dropout bias supply with an output voltage of 7.8 V and is internally current limited to 30 mA).

  7. What is the package type of the LM5088?

    The LM5088 is available in a thermally enhanced 16-pin HTSSOP package.

  8. What are some typical applications of the LM5088?

    Typical applications include automotive infotainment, automotive USB accessory adapters, industrial DC-DC bias and motor drivers, and telecom applications).

  9. Is the LM5088 AEC-Q100 qualified?

    Yes, the LM5088 is AEC-Q100 qualified with a device temperature grade 1: –40°C to +125°C ambient operating temperature range).

  10. What is the feedback reference voltage of the LM5088?

    The feedback reference voltage of the LM5088 is 1.205 V with 1.5% accuracy).
